I use both FRFR and guitar cab at the same time. I have a Xitone 1x12 FRFR speaker plugged into one output and a Matrix NL12 "traditional" guitar cab plugged into the other side. Since I'm setup like this, I have to put an "FXL" block into every preset, right in front of the "CAB" block. What that does is gives the Xitone FRFR speaker full FRFR (output 1), and the Matrix NL12 no cab simulation (output 2 into FXL). Really enjoying the setup.
I used to use two Marshall 4x12 cabs and loved the setup but I wanted to be able to use cab sims because unless I'm playing songs that only bands with Marshall cabs use, I can't really effectively capture a ton of sounds. I liked the sound coming thru real speaker cabs more but the FRFR is more flexible.
